What do legal services do?

Law services provide legal advice, defend you in case of a crime, settle lawsuits and other legal actions, and represent you in court.

What is legal services?

Legal service is the rendering of advice and representation by a lawyer in a legal matter. There are many types of legal services, from divorce to criminal defense. Whatever your situation, a lawyer can be of help.

What are legal services jobs?

Legal services jobs mainly dominate in corporate law, entertainment law, commercial law, literary law, criminal law, and immigration law.
